引言
微信小程序作为一种新兴的应用形式,因其便捷性、低成本和高用户粘性而受到广泛关注。然而,对于许多开发者而言,小程序开发过程中涉及的费用问题常常成为制约其发展的瓶颈。本文将为您揭秘微信小程序开发的零成本攻略,帮助您告别付费困境,轻松上手小程序开发。
一、了解微信小程序开发基础
1.1 开发环境搭建
在开始开发之前,您需要准备以下开发环境:
- 操作系统:Windows、macOS 或 Linux
- 开发工具:微信开发者工具(支持 Windows、macOS 和 Linux)
- 代码编辑器:如 Visual Studio Code、Sublime Text 等
- Node.js 环境:版本要求 4.4 或以上
1.2 开发框架
微信小程序官方推荐使用 WXML(类似 HTML)、WXSS(类似 CSS)和 JavaScript 进行开发。此外,还有第三方框架可供选择,如 WePY、Taro 等。
二、免费资源获取
2.1 开发者文档与教程
微信官方开发者文档提供了详尽的开发指南和教程,涵盖基础知识、组件、API 等各个方面。这些资源免费且全面,是开发者必备的学习资料。
2.2 开发工具
微信开发者工具免费提供,功能强大,支持实时预览、调试等功能,助力开发者高效开发。
2.3 代码模板
社区中有很多免费的微信小程序代码模板,涵盖了各种类型的场景,如电商、餐饮、旅游等。您可以根据自己的需求选择合适的模板进行修改和扩展。
三、节省成本的技巧
3.1 避免重复开发
在开发过程中,尽量避免重复造轮子。您可以通过搜索社区资源,利用现有的组件和功能,降低开发成本。
3.2 优化代码结构
合理的代码结构有助于提高开发效率和降低后期维护成本。例如,采用模块化开发、代码复用等技术。
3.3 充分利用免费 API
微信开放平台提供了丰富的免费 API,您可以在开发过程中充分利用这些资源,实现更多功能。
四、案例分析
以下是一些实现零成本开发的微信小程序案例:
- 电商小程序:利用免费 API 获取商品数据,通过自定义组件展示商品信息,实现购物车、订单等功能。
- 餐饮小程序:整合外卖平台接口,实现在线点餐、支付等功能。
- 旅游小程序:展示景点信息、地图导航、评论等功能,提高用户旅游体验。
五、总结
通过以上攻略,相信您已经掌握了微信小程序开发的零成本技巧。在实际开发过程中,不断学习、积累经验,相信您将能够打造出更多优质的小程序产品。祝您在微信小程序开发的道路上越走越远!
